Biography
Penelope Kenny is an experienced non-executive, senior independent director (SID) and Chartered Accountant with a track record as an effective non-executive Director and chair of Audit and Risk Committees. She has held an extensive range of key positions in varied corporate instruments including plcs, dacs, private companies and state bodies. Penelope is a Senior Independent director of Kroo Ltd (a fintech bank), she is Chair of Audit committee and member of the Risk committee at Kroo, she has been approved by the Bank of England for that role. She consults in Sustainability and CSRD disclosures through Centigo a Swedish consulting group. She has led compliance work on the implementation of the Code of Practice for the Governance of State Bodies 2016, both as a consultant to a state body and as chair of Audit and Risk committees. In 2021 she achieved the international certificate in corporate governance from INSEAD International Directorship Program (IDP), France, and the Leading from the Chair certificate (2023). INSEAD is No.1 FT- Global MBA Ranking.
She is a member of the Institute of Directors and an affiliate of the Irish Chartered Secretaries Association.
She holds a master’s degree in Cultural Policy from University College Dublin in December 2014 her book on Corporate Governance was published by the Chartered Accountants Ireland. She has a keen interest in visual arts and has been a Director of the Irish Museum of Modern art and is currently a Director of the Crawford Gallery Cork.
A Fellow of the Institute of Chartered Accountants in Ireland, Penelope was a Council member of the Institute - the governing and strategy body for all Irish Chartered accountants. She has been chairman of the Leinster Society of Chartered Accountants, a body of over 6000 members; Ms. Kenny has direct experience in financial services, property, construction, accounting, banking, and management consulting.
She has lectured on Corporate governance to Masters degree students in UCD and presents to Chartered Accountants Ireland Continuing Professional Development programs (CPD), she has also been visiting lecturer to the DCU business Masters program.
